Output 8e572a307736a8fda3913af988d85031b623cdf4b47bb10e406876bd589f04e8:0

value
268300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7cb223b8ae7b2487ed09169069d6d4f89f50a23 OP_EQUAL
address
3NpdMqP3AdyQSkPNkPm8cdsHjJNNBdqpLf
transaction
8e572a307736a8fda3913af988d85031b623cdf4b47bb10e406876bd589f04e8
spent
true